rnPersonalisation of care is one of the major transformative thoughts that have revolutionized the realm of social care services for adults. This new approach is specifically tailored to allow individuals to live independently benefitting from absolute choice and control in their lives. In clearer terms, each receiver of some form of social support should be conferred with the right to choose and control the shape of that support system in all care settings, whether provided by constitutional services or funded by themselves. Personalisation of Care – An Overview The new personalisation of care outlook is in concomitant with the “Putting People First” vision proposed by the UK Government in 2007. The initiative aims to discover innovative ways to enhance the social care scenario in England. Personalisation of care in the social service setting aspires to place persons who are in need of support in the driving seat. They will have active participation in deciding and building their system of care and support to meet their own exceptional requirements. This new thinking replaces the much celebrated traditional notion of “one size fits all” system. The Social Care Institute for Excellence (SCIE) in the UK, which identifies and shares knowledge about good practice, has issued a detailed guide on personalization in the context of social care. The revised version of the guide intends to keep people posted about the changing notions on care and support. Cutting edge practitioners and first-line administrators in statutory and independent sector social care services can benefit from these guidelines profusely. By promoting this person-centred approach, the guide endorses the nurturing power of personalised care. This personalisation of care approach is not only applicable to social care and support services, but will be effectively implanted into other key public service sectors, for instance, health and education. This kind of sweeping reform of public services means that individuals will receive their own budget with the freedom to participate in the progression of identifying their needs and making preferences about how and when they are supported to live their lives. Personalisation of care approach gives significant place to the person’s specific strengths, preferences and aspirations. This means that staff and services need to be equipped to absorb the basic fundamentals of this adult social care transformation wind. Since personalisation of care starts with the person rather than the service, it will enable people to live their own lives as they aspire without sacrificing their own individual needs for independence, safety, and self-esteem.
